How to fill out policy - pharmacy practice:

01
Research and familiarize yourself with the specific policies and guidelines that are relevant to pharmacy practice. This may involve reading through regulatory documents, professional association guidelines, and any specific policies set by your organization or institution.
02
Begin by understanding the purpose and scope of the policy - pharmacy practice. This will help you determine what information and details need to be included in the policy.
03
Create a clear and concise policy statement that outlines the objectives and goals of the pharmacy practice policy.
04
Identify the key aspects and components that need to be addressed in the policy. This may include areas such as medication handling and storage, dispensing procedures, patient counseling, pharmacist responsibilities, and compliance with regulatory requirements.
05
Conduct a thorough review of existing policies and procedures that relate to pharmacy practice within your organization. This will help ensure that the policy being developed aligns with existing practices and avoids duplication or contradictions.
06
Consult with relevant stakeholders such as pharmacists, pharmacy technicians, and other healthcare professionals to gather input and feedback on the policy. This will help ensure that the policy is comprehensive, practical, and reflects the needs of those who will be involved in its implementation.
07
Include specific guidelines and protocols in the policy for handling situations such as medication errors, adverse events, and drug recalls. This will help guide staff on how to respond effectively and appropriately in challenging situations.
08
Clearly outline the processes and procedures for documenting and maintaining records related to pharmacy practice. This may include requirements for documentation of medication orders, patient consultations, medication administration, and any other relevant information.
09
Review the policy for clarity, accuracy, and completeness. Ensure that all necessary information is included and that the language used is clear and understandable.
10
Once the policy - pharmacy practice is finalized, distribute it to all relevant staff members, ensuring that they are aware of its existence and have access to a copy. Provide training and education as needed to ensure understanding and adherence to the policy.
